JAKARTA - Cabinet Secretary Teddy Indra Wijaya said that the discussion on cutting ministers' salaries would still be discussed at a meeting to be held in the next few days.

The Secretary of the Cabinet said that various concepts related to the discourse would still be discussed further.

"So, the point is that these concepts will be tightened in the next few days," he said, quoted by ANTARA, Tuesday, April 7.

He emphasized that there was no decision yet regarding the plan to cut the ministers' salaries.

"Later we will see. There is no decision yet," said Teddy.

Teddy then directed the journalists to ask the party who first raised the discourse.

"Ask who delivered, yesterday who was it?" said Teddy.

As previously reported, Minister of Finance Purbaya Yudhi Sadewa did not mind the discussion of cutting ministers' salaries. However, he is still waiting for a formal decision from President Prabowo Subianto.

"If (salary cuts) the DPR I don't know. If the minister is okay, we'll see what the President's policy is like," said Purbaya at the Coordinating Ministry for Economic Affairs, Jakarta, Monday (6/4).

On that occasion, Purbaya estimated the amount of the minister's salary cut to be around 25 percent.

"I think it's 25 percent," he said.

On a different occasion, Purbaya said his party would set the percentage of direct cuts in the ministry and agency budget as a step to increase the efficiency of the State Budget (APBN) amid rising global economic uncertainty due to geopolitical tensions in the Middle East.

"I asked the ministry to cut it themselves, but if they were asked like that they didn't want to cut it, they raised everything. If I can determine it, I will cut it by a certain percentage, then they will adjust it," said Purbaya at the Presidential Palace complex, Jakarta, Thursday (19/3).

Purbaya explained that the Ministry of Finance would comb through the components of spending that were considered to be temporarily postponed. The focus on efficiency targets programs that do not have a significant impact or have a slow acceleration on national economic growth.

In addition to efficiency at the program level, the discourse on cutting the salaries of ministers and deputy ministers also emerged as part of state budget savings. Purbaya expressed his support for the proposal as a concrete step of solidarity between state officials in saving spending.

"Agree. Oh that's good. If it's good," said the Minister of Finance in response to a question about the plan to cut the salaries of officials at the ministerial level.
